This charming holiday cottage dates back to the 18th century & has been lovingly restored to its former farmhouse glory. The cottage takes its name from the Lyke Wake Walk, started in the 1950's by Bill Cowley who owned the farm at the time.
Located just outside Potto on a quite country road, Lyke Wake Cottage is close to the village of Swainby and offers fantastic views across lovely open countryside. It provides the perfect place for a relaxing holiday in North Yorkshire and can comfortably accommodate up to five guests in three bedrooms.
The quaint village of Swainby, with its pretty stream (with resident ducks!), village shop and two pubs is located on the western fringe of the North York Moors National Park. The local area is absolutely perfect for walkers with direct access to the North York Moors and its many footpaths including the Cleveland Way. The National Cycle Route 65 runs directly through Swainby, making it ideal too for those who enjoy cycling.
There are numerous attractions and places of interest to visit including; Heroit country, Castle Howard Stately Home, Heartbeat country, the famous North York Moors Steam Railway and the town of Helmsley with its array of quaint shops. Further afield is the stunning City of York and Yorkshires stunning Heritage east coast, both within easy driving distance and well worth a day trip. Why not visit the beautiful coastal fishing villages of Staithes and Runswick Bay or explore the Victorian sea side town of Saltburn and Sandsends with its expanse of sandy beach extending down the coast to the lively town of Whitby.

Accommodation comprises:
Fully equipped kitchen with electric fan oven, hob/extractor fan, washer, fridge/freezer, dishwasher, microwave, electric kettle, coffee maker, toastie maker, toaster and iron/ironing board. Tea towels and kitchen towels are provided along with washing tablets, dishwasher tablets, softener, toilet rolls and tissues.
Lounge complete with colour TV, DVD player, inglenook fireplace (with log effect electric fanheater), three seater and two seater settee plus an arm chair.
Dining area with a table and six chairs and French windows opening out onto the patio complete with patio furniture, and wonderful views onto open country side.
Romantic King-sized bedroom with king-sized brass/white bed, two bedside cabinets with touch lamps, dressing table and mirror with stool and a chest of drawers. There is also a fitted wardrobe, feature fireplace, rocking chair and Laura Ashley curtains.
Double bedroom with chest of drawers, chair and bedside table with touch lamp. There are lovely views of the nearby countryside.
Single bedroom with bedside table with touch lamp, pine wardrobe, cabinet, mirror and excellent views.
Bathroom with a bath/shower over, sink and toilet. There is a heated towel rail with towels and complimentary toiletries are supplied.
Additional information: The cosy ambience is enhanced by the under floor heating. Guests will be greeted with a welcome pack containing; milk, bread, bacon. butter, jam, fresh farm eggs, biscuits, coffee and tea. Wine and flowers also provided.
